Additional information

This collaboration with Zhejiang University in the Cambridge - Zhejiang Joint Research Centre, formed in 2005, followed similar studies in the Samsung main business divisions in 1998-2002, and demonstrated that similar processes from imitation to innovation occurred not only in Korea but also in China and possibly in other developing countries. This research helped to win a Natural Science Foundation of China (NSFC) Research Grant (No. 71232013) for the joint research centre (RMB2.4M; January 2013 to December 2017).
